Kittens do the majority of their growth in the first five to six months of life but continue to grow until they are around one year old. During this time of rapid growth and maturation of their bones, it is very important to choose a complete and balanced diet with the appropriate levels of nutrients. Diets formulated for growth include those labeled for kittens or “all life stages.” Canned foods promote increased water consumption in cats, and feeding dry food exclusively or in combination with canned is also acceptable. Offering a kitten with a variety of textures early in life can be helpful in minimizing the chance of having a picky eater. Regardless of diet selection, always make diet changes gradually by mixing the old and new foods together over five to seven days and make sure to carefully measure the appropriate portions of your cat’s food. Abrupt changes have a greater likelihood of resulting in vomiting and/or diarrhea.
